Burbank is a city in Los Angeles County in Southern California. It had a population of 103,879 as of the 2020 census. Burbank was incorporated as a city in 1911 and is located 12 miles northwest of downtown Los Angeles.

Population and Demographics

As mentioned above, Burbank had a population of 103,879 in 2020 according to the US Census. This makes it the 12th largest city in Los Angeles County. The population density is 5,800 people per square mile. The racial makeup of Burbank is approximately 66% White, 9% Asian, 3% Black or African American, and 26% Hispanic or Latino.

History of Burbank

Burbank's recorded history began in 1790 when the area that is now Burbank was part of the Spanish land grant Rancho San Rafael. In 1867, Dr. David Burbank, an American dentist, purchased over 4,600 acres of the former ranch lands and established a sheep ranch. The city began in 1887 when 160 acres near the railroad depot were purchased and subdivided into lots. The town was named Burbank in honor of Dr. Burbank and incorporated as a city in 1911 with a population of 1,385.

Burbank's early history and subsequent growth was closely tied to the railroad and the entertainment industry. In the 1920s major facilities were built for Warner Bros and several other movie studios. Walt Disney opened his studios in Burbank in 1939. This established Burbank as the media capital of the West Coast.

Economy and Major Employers

As home to major entertainment studios such as Warner Bros., Walt Disney Studios, ABC, Nickelodeon Animation Studios, and more, the media and entertainment industry dominates Burbank's economy. However, the city also has a diversified economic base with companies in aerospace, technology, fashion, and other sectors.

Public Transportation

Burbank is served by several bus routes operated by the BurbankBus and Metro. The downtown Burbank Metro station provides access to the Metro B Line light rail. From there, connections can be made around the Los Angeles area. Burbank is also served by Metrolink commuter rail at the Burbank Airport station.

Education

Public education in Burbank is managed by the Burbank Unified School District. The district serves over 15,000 students across 17 elementary, middle, and high schools. There are also several private schools in Burbank as well as charter schools.

Burbank's higher education options include Woodbury University and several community colleges nearby. The city's educated population and workforce has helped fuel its media, technology, and other industries.
